Subject: South Pasadena Public Library to Host First Death Café
South Pasadena, Calif. – The South Pasadena Public Library invites the community to its first Death Café on Friday, February 13, 2026, at 7:00 p.m. in the Library Community Room, located at 1115 El Centro Street, South Pasadena, CA 91030. The event will be hosted and facilitated by Emily Yacina, musical artist and Death Café facilitator, who has led multiple Death Cafés across Southern California.
A Death Café is an informal discussion group where participants talk openly about death without agenda, objectives, or themes. These gatherings are not grief support or counseling sessions but provide a respectful, accessible, and confidential space for conversation. Light refreshments will be served.
Death Cafés have grown rapidly across Europe, North America, and Australasia. Since September 2011, over 28,000 Death Cafés have been held in 97 countries, reflecting both the public’s curiosity about discussing death and the growing number of individuals passionate enough to organize their own gatherings. About the City of South Pasadena
The City of South Pasadena is a charming community, situated only six miles from downtown Los Angeles. Called the City of Trees, the area is known for its stunning homes, unique small businesses, and top-quality schools. South Pasadena’s diverse population of about 25,000 occupies a mere 3.44 square miles of flatlands and hillsides on the west side of the San Gabriel Valley. This small-town atmosphere makes South Pasadena one of California's most desirable locations.
